The Novo Nordisk Foundation

The Novo Nordisk Foundation is a Danish self-governing foundation

The objective of the Foundation is To provide a stable basis for the

commercial and research activities conducted by the companies in the Novo Group

To support scientific and humanitarian purposes

Thematic Grants

The Novo Nordisk Foundation Center for Protein Research at the University of Copenhagen with DKK 600 million in 2007.

The Danish National Biobank at Statens Serum Institut with DKK 85 million in 2009.

The Novo Nordisk Foundation Center for Basic Metabolic Research at the University of Copenhagen with DKK 885 million in 2010.

Endocrinological Research – Nordic Region

Basic and clinical research in endocrinology. Limited project or a clearly defined part of a major project (in the latter case, a

summary of the major project should be included). Can be applied for by researchers in Denmark, Finland, Iceland, Norway and

Sweden. Operational expenses and technical assistance, including payroll costs for other

researchers for a limited period of time. Also available for the salary of the main applicant - to cover full-time research

for a limited period of time and on condition that the main applicant can be released from other work during this period.

Not available for applications concerning cancer research. Not available for travel or printing expenses. Not available for major equipment expenses (in excess of DKK 50,000).

Clinical Nursing Research - Denmark

Masters or PhD education for nurses. As for PhD students the main applicant must be registered for an education at a Danish university at the time of application.

Postdoctoral education for nurses. It is possible to apply for funding to study abroad and to cover operating expenses including student assistant, development of new research methods and theories etc.

It is possible to apply for a limited project or a clearly defined part of a major project. The main applicant must be a nurse. Applicants who have previously received funding for the same project and who want to apply again must state the progress of the research project in the application.

Applications for less than DKK 50,000 will not be considered.

Scholarships

The Novo Nordisk Foundation awards a number of scholarships at different levels every year, primarily for health research.

All scholarships are awarded with specific deadlines based on calls for applications, submission of applications and expert assessment.

The scholarships include payroll contributions and, normally, varying operating contributions. The duration of the scholarships is 2-5 years.

There are currently 53 scholarships in progress.

Click icon to add picture

Page 19: Københavns Universitet 26. oktober 2010 The Novo Nordisk Foundation History and Grant Areas

Clinical Research Scholarships

Applications for clinical research scholarships are assessed by the Medical and Scientific Research Committee.

Five-year scholarships for senior researchers in full-time clinical positions with a view to partial release of the researcher from the clinical position.

The scholarship is to ensure that significant research activity can be maintained alongside a clinical position with a view to ensuring continuity in research and research guidance.

The scholarship is for a total of DKK 2.5 million and is awarded in annual installments of DKK 500,000 to cover the salary of a person who is qualified to undertake the clinical responsibilities of the clinical researcher holding the scholarship.

Hallas-Møller Scholarship - Denmark

Applications are assessed by the Medical and Scientific Research Committee.

Five-year scholarships for senior researchers. Danish research in medicine and natural science, preferably within the fields of basic biomedical research, translational research and clinical research.

Two scholarships are awarded per year. The total payment during the scholarship amounts to DKK 11 mio. The payment per year is DKK 2.2 mio. at the maximum. The amount is covering own salary and also operational expenses up to DKK

1.5 mio. p.a.

Postdoctoral Scholarships in General Practice/Family Medicine – Denmark

Objective: To support research in general medicine, especially to retain physicians as researchers in the general medicine research environments at or in association with the universities.

Requirements: Applicants must have earned a PhD or have similar academic qualifications.

Grant: There are two full two-year scholarships available, each of DKK 500,000 p.a. It is possible to apply for a half scholarship if the applicant wishes to maintain clinical responsibilities during the scholarship period.

Symposia

Novo Nordisk Foundation Research Meetings Grants for the hosting of symposia in the Nordic Region, possibly as satellite

symposia in connection with large conferences, or grants for the invitation of leading international researchers for short-term sojourns with a research team combined with open lectures or the like. Grants are not available for holding courses.

The theme of the activity must be within endocrinology or experimental physiology. Each grant is normally in the order of DKK 100,000 or more.

It is possible to apply in 2010 for projects to take place in 2011 and 2012.
